Abstract

Psychopharmacology is common in mental health care. Health service psychologists routinely provide services to clients prescribed psychotropic medications, and work within multidisciplinary collaborations. As a result, foundational knowledge of psychopharmacology is necessary. The primary objectives of this study were to evaluate the number of American Psychological Association (APA)-accredited doctoral programs in clinical psychology that require a course in clinical psychopharmacology in their curriculum and to identify potential barriers preventing programs from offering this coursework. All clinical psychology programs accredited by the APA were surveyed to determine their requirement of a course related to psychopharmacology. Program information was initially reviewed online and in the absence of clear indication within their program websites, survey questions were sent to program administrators. Data were obtained from 216 of the 254 APA-accredited programs (85%). Of these, 66 programs (31%) required a course in psychopharmacology. This equates to 48% of the total number of students from programs where data were obtained. Barriers to coursework being offered were identified in 25% of responding programs, reflecting lack of room in the curriculum, insufficient faculty expertise, and inconsistent student interest. Despite the frequent utilization of psychotropic medications in mental health treatment, less than a third of responding doctoral programs required a course in psychopharmacology in their curriculums. It is argued that a foundational understanding of clinical psychopharmacology may be particularly important for those working in integrated behavioral health care settings. APA accreditation status should include that graduate training curricula require a course in psychopharmacology.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
